Karnataka NEET UG 2026 counselling will be conducted by the Karnataka Examination Authority (KEA) Karnataka Examination Authority for admission into MBBS, BDS, and AYUSH courses in Karnataka. The counselling process starts after the NEET UG 2026 exam, which was scheduled on 3 May 2026 (Sunday) as per the NTA timetable. After the result, candidates can register online, choose their preferred colleges, and take part in seat allotment through the official KEA CET Online Portal.

 

Students who qualify NEET UG 2026 can join different counselling rounds like Round 1, Round 2, and Mop-Up round. They must complete registration, upload documents, and carefully fill their choices. Seat allotment is done based on NEET rank, category, and seat availability in colleges. Karnataka NEET UG 2026 Counselling Process

The Karnataka Examinations Authority conducts Karnataka NEET UG 2026 counselling for admission to MBBS, BDS, and other medical courses through NEET UG. Qualified candidates must take part in the online counselling process, which includes registration, document verification, choice filling, and seat allotment.

 

Step 1: NEET UG 2026 QualificationCandidates must first qualify the NEET UG 2026 exam conducted by the National Testing Agency. Admission to medical courses will depend on the candidate’s NEET rank, category, and eligibility criteria set by the authorities.

 

Step 2: Online RegistrationEligible candidates need to complete online registration on the KEA official portal. During this process, they must enter personal and academic details, upload the required documents, and pay the counselling registration fee. The entire process is done online.

 

Step 3: Document VerificationAfter registration, candidates must go through document verification. KEA may conduct this verification either online or at designated centres. Only candidates whose documents are successfully verified will be allowed to proceed to the next stage.

 

Step 4: Merit List PublicationKEA releases the Karnataka NEET 2026 Merit List based on NEET scores and eligibility. Candidates should carefully check their name, NEET rank, category, and other eligibility details in the published list.

 

Step 5: Choice Filling and LockingCandidates must select their preferred medical colleges, dental colleges, and courses during choice filling. After selection, they must lock their choices carefully. Seat allotment depends on NEET rank, reservation category, seat availability, and candidate preferences.

 

Step 6: Seat Allotment ResultKEA publishes the seat allotment result online. Candidates who are allotted a seat must download the allotment letter, choose their option such as accept or upgrade, and pay the required admission fee to confirm their seat.

 

Step 7: Reporting to College & Final VerificationCandidates must report to the allotted college within the deadline with original documents for final verification and admission confirmation. Required documents include:

  • NEET UG scorecard
  • Admit card
  • Class 10 & 12 certificates
  • Domicile certificate (if applicable)
  • Category certificate
  • ID proof and photographs

Karnataka NEET UG 2026 Counselling: Documents Required

The Karnataka Examinations Authority conducts Karnataka NEET UG 2026 Counselling for admission through NEET UG. Candidates must carry the required documents during verification and admission to confirm their eligibility and secure their seat.

  • NEET UG 2026 Scorecard
  • NEET UG 2026 Admit Card
  • Class 10 Marksheet and Passing Certificate (for date of birth proof)
  • Class 12 Marksheet and Passing Certificate
  • Transfer Certificate (TC)
  • Conduct/Character Certificate
  • Recent Passport Size Photographs
  • Valid Photo ID Proof (Aadhaar Card/PAN Card/Passport)
  • Karnataka Domicile Certificate (if applicable)
  • Category Certificate (SC/ST/OBC/EWS, if applicable)
  • PwD Certificate (if applicable)
  • Income Certificate (if required for fee concession)
  • Allotment Letter (issued after seat allotment)

Karnataka NEET 2026 Counselling FAQs

Who conducts Karnataka NEET UG 2026 counselling?

The Karnataka Examinations Authority conducts Karnataka NEET counselling for admission to MBBS, BDS, and AYUSH courses in government and private colleges.

When will Karnataka NEET UG 2026 counselling start?

Counselling is expected to begin in July 2026 after the declaration of NEET UG results.

Who is eligible for Karnataka NEET counselling?

Candidates who qualify for NEET UG 2026 and meet eligibility criteria like age, education, and domicile (for state quota) can participate in the counselling process.

How can I register for Karnataka NEET counselling?

Candidates must register online on the official KEA website, fill in details, upload documents, and pay the counselling fee to complete registration.

What is the counselling fee for Karnataka NEET 2026?

The fee is INR 2,500 for General/OBC, INR 500 for SC/ST/PwD, and INR 5,500 for NRI/foreign candidates, payable online during registration.

What documents are required for counselling?

Important documents include NEET scorecard, admit card, Class 10 & 12 certificates, domicile certificate, category certificate, ID proof, and passport-size photographs.

How is seat allotment done in Karnataka NEET counselling?

Seat allotment is based on NEET rank, category, reservation rules, preferences filled by candidates, and availability of seats in colleges.

How many rounds are there in Karnataka NEET counselling?

There are usually three rounds: Round 1, Round 2, and the Mop-Up round to fill remaining vacant seats in colleges.

Can I participate in multiple counselling rounds?

Yes, candidates can participate in multiple rounds to upgrade their seat or get a better college based on their NEET rank and availability.

What is the expected cutoff for Karnataka NEET 2026?

Expected cutoff varies by category. The general category may need 560–620+ for government colleges, while private colleges may have lower cutoff ranges.

What happens after seat allotment?

Candidates must download the allotment letter, pay fees, and report to the allotted college with original documents for final admission confirmation.

Is Karnataka domicile required for counselling?

Domicile is required for 85% state quota seats. However, non-Karnataka candidates can apply for private college seats under KEA counselling.
